What B12 Injections Do (And Why They Can Help)
Vitamin B12 (cobalamin) is involved in red blood cell formation, neurological function, and energy metabolism. When B12 status is low, it can affect oxygen delivery (via red blood cells) and the nervous system (via myelin maintenance), which is why symptoms often show up as fatigue, weakness, tingling or numbness, and difficulty concentrating.
Injections bypass digestion and absorption—an important distinction. In my experience, the biggest “why” behind B12 injections is not that they’re magical; it’s that they’re reliable when absorption is impaired. Some people struggle to absorb B12 due to stomach acid issues, inflammatory gut conditions, certain medications, or dietary patterns that don’t provide enough B12 over time.
Key benefits you may notice when B12 is appropriate
- Energy support: Many people experience improved stamina once levels are corrected, especially if the fatigue was truly B12-driven.
- Neurological symptom relief: Tingling, numbness, and “pins and needles” can improve if treatment starts early enough.
- Red blood cell and oxygen transport support: Correcting deficiency can address anemia-related fatigue and weakness.
- Better metabolic function: B12 plays a role in normal cellular energy pathways.

How Do You Know If You Need a B12 Injection?
This is the central issue: how do you know if you need a b12 injection without relying on symptoms alone. Symptoms overlap with iron deficiency, vitamin D deficiency, thyroid problems, sleep issues, and even stress or burnout—so we use a layered approach: history, risk factors, and lab testing.
1) Look at your risk factors (where absorption is commonly impaired)
In my hands-on assessments, these are the scenarios where injections are often considered because oral absorption may be unreliable:
- Age-related absorption changes: Some people produce less stomach acid as they get older, which can reduce B12 absorption.
- Gastritis or inflammatory gut conditions: Conditions affecting the stomach or small intestine can interfere with B12 handling.
- History of bariatric surgery: Procedures that change the digestive tract can reduce effective absorption.
- Pernicious anemia or suspected autoimmune gastritis: This is a classic driver of low B12.
- Long-term use of certain medications: Metformin (commonly), and acid reducers like PPIs or H2 blockers (often) can be associated with lower B12 status over time.
- Dietary pattern: If you avoid animal products and aren’t consistently supplementing, deficiency becomes more plausible.
2) Use symptom patterns—but confirm with tests
Symptoms that may align with B12 deficiency include:
- Persistent fatigue or weakness
- Shortness of breath with activity (sometimes linked to anemia)
- Difficulty concentrating or memory issues (“brain fog”)
- Glossitis (inflamed tongue)
- Neurological symptoms: tingling, numbness, balance changes
Important: In my experience, symptoms are not specific enough to “diagnose” B12 deficiency. I treat symptoms as signals for testing, not proof.
3) Confirm with bloodwork (the most trustworthy path)
When clinicians assess B12 deficiency, they typically start with one or more of the following:
- Serum vitamin B12: A basic indicator, but it can be less reliable in borderline cases.
- MMA (methylmalonic acid): Often helpful when B12 levels are borderline and you want metabolic confirmation.
- Homocysteine: Can rise with B12 deficiency and also varies with other nutritional factors.
- CBC (complete blood count): Checks for anemia patterns that may align with deficiency.
My practical approach: If someone has clear risk factors plus symptoms, I push for at least a serum B12 and CBC, and I advocate follow-up testing (MMA and/or homocysteine) when results are borderline or symptoms suggest deficiency.
4) Consider whether oral B12 is sufficient (and when injections become more relevant)
Some people can correct deficiency with high-dose oral B12, especially if there’s still functional absorption. In contrast, injections are commonly chosen when:
- Deficiency is significant
- Neurological symptoms are present
- Absorption is likely impaired
- Oral treatment hasn’t worked or adherence is difficult
So “how do you know” becomes: Do my risk factors and labs point to true deficiency and limited absorption?
What to Expect From B12 Injection Treatment
People often want immediate answers about timelines and what changes should be felt. From real-world patterns I’ve observed, responses vary based on how low B12 was, how long deficiency persisted, and whether the underlying cause was addressed.
Typical response patterns
- Energy and mood-related symptoms: Can improve over days to weeks after deficiency correction.
- Neurological symptoms: May take longer; early treatment generally has better odds of improvement.
- Lab markers: Should move in the right direction as therapy continues.
Potential downsides and limitations (staying objective)
- Not a substitute for diagnosis: If symptoms come from another cause (thyroid, anemia from iron deficiency, sleep issues), injections won’t solve the root problem.
- Overcorrecting can be unhelpful: Unnecessary injections without evidence can add cost and distract from proper care.
- Side effects: Reactions can include mild discomfort at injection sites for some people. Significant reactions are uncommon but should be medically assessed.
- Underlying cause still matters: If absorption is impaired, ongoing monitoring or a tailored plan may be needed.
How to Decide Between B12 Injections and Other Options
Here’s a decision framework I’ve used with clients and patients to keep choices grounded:
Use this quick checklist
- Do you have risk factors for low B12 absorption (medications, GI issues, surgery, autoimmune gastritis, dietary limits)?
- Do your symptoms match a possible deficiency pattern (especially fatigue plus possible neurological signs)?
- Do you have lab results showing low B12 or supporting metabolic deficiency (MMA/homocysteine)?
- Have you tried oral supplementation, and if so, did it actually move your levels?
If you answer “yes” to the risk factors plus confirmation by labs, injections are often a practical and efficient route. If you don’t, it may be worth addressing other causes and choosing the least invasive approach first.

How do you know if you need a b12 injection instead of just supplements?
You typically know by combining risk factors for poor absorption with bloodwork. Symptoms alone aren’t reliable. Lab testing such as serum B12 and, when needed, MMA and/or homocysteine helps confirm true deficiency and supports whether injections are appropriate.
Can you feel better quickly after a B12 injection?
Some people notice improvements in energy within days to a few weeks if the deficiency is genuine. Neurological symptoms may take longer and may improve more slowly—especially if deficiency has been present for a long time.
What symptoms suggest you should test your B12 levels promptly?
Persistent fatigue or weakness, anemia-like symptoms, and neurological signs like tingling, numbness, or balance issues are good reasons to test and follow up with a clinician rather than guessing.
